1
0
mirror of https://github.com/kremalicious/portfolio.git synced 2024-06-29 00:57:41 +02:00

more portfolio images

This commit is contained in:
Matthias Kretschmann 2018-04-17 22:35:02 +02:00
parent 7c5fff1cdd
commit 6dc0237256
Signed by: m
GPG Key ID: 606EEEF3C479A91F
9 changed files with 37 additions and 14 deletions

View File

@ -3,6 +3,10 @@
"title": "Ocean Protocol", "title": "Ocean Protocol",
"slug": "oceanprotocol", "slug": "oceanprotocol",
"img": "oceanprotocol", "img": "oceanprotocol",
"img_more": [
"oceanprotocol01",
"oceanprotocol02"
],
"links": { "links": {
"Link": "https://oceanprotocol.com" "Link": "https://oceanprotocol.com"
}, },
@ -22,6 +26,10 @@
"title": "IPDB", "title": "IPDB",
"slug": "ipdb", "slug": "ipdb",
"img": "ipdb", "img": "ipdb",
"img_more": [
"ipdb01",
"ipdb02"
],
"links": { "links": {
"Link": "https://ipdb.io", "Link": "https://ipdb.io",
"GitHub": "https://github.com/ipdb/website" "GitHub": "https://github.com/ipdb/website"
@ -80,7 +88,8 @@
"img": "bigchaindb", "img": "bigchaindb",
"img_more": [ "img_more": [
"bigchaindb01", "bigchaindb01",
"bigchaindb02" "bigchaindb02",
"bigchaindb03"
], ],
"links": { "links": {
"Link": "https://www.bigchaindb.com", "Link": "https://www.bigchaindb.com",

View File

@ -1,8 +1,9 @@
import React from 'react' import React, { Fragment } from 'react'
import Link from 'gatsby-link' import Link from 'gatsby-link'
import PropTypes from 'prop-types' import PropTypes from 'prop-types'
import Social from './Social' import FadeIn from '../atoms/FadeIn'
import { Logo } from '../atoms/Icons' import { Logo } from '../atoms/Icons'
import Social from './Social'
import './Header.scss' import './Header.scss'
const Header = ({ meta, isHomepage }) => { const Header = ({ meta, isHomepage }) => {
@ -10,13 +11,16 @@ const Header = ({ meta, isHomepage }) => {
return ( return (
<header className={classes}> <header className={classes}>
<Link className="header__name" to={'/'}> <FadeIn>
<Logo className="header__logo" /> <Fragment>
<h1 className="header__title">{meta.title.toLowerCase()}</h1> <Link className="header__name" to={'/'}>
<p className="header__description"><span>{'{ '}</span> {meta.tagline.toLowerCase()} <span>{' }'}</span></p> <Logo className="header__logo" />
</Link> <h1 className="header__title">{meta.title.toLowerCase()}</h1>
<p className="header__description"><span>{'{ '}</span> {meta.tagline.toLowerCase()} <span>{' }'}</span></p>
<Social meta={meta} minimal={!isHomepage} hide={!isHomepage} /> </Link>
<Social meta={meta} minimal={!isHomepage} hide={!isHomepage} />
</Fragment>
</FadeIn>
</header> </header>
) )
} }

View File

@ -1,10 +1,15 @@
import oceanprotocol from './portfolio-oceanprotocol.png' import oceanprotocol from './portfolio-oceanprotocol.png'
import oceanprotocol01 from './portfolio-oceanprotocol-01.png'
import oceanprotocol02 from './portfolio-oceanprotocol-02.png'
import ipdb from './portfolio-ipdb.png' import ipdb from './portfolio-ipdb.png'
import ipdb01 from './portfolio-ipdb-01.png'
import ipdb02 from './portfolio-ipdb-02.png'
import biv from './portfolio-biv.png' import biv from './portfolio-biv.png'
import ninenineeightfour from './portfolio-9984.png' import ninenineeightfour from './portfolio-9984.png'
import bigchaindb from './portfolio-bigchaindb.png' import bigchaindb from './portfolio-bigchaindb.png'
import bigchaindb01 from './portfolio-bigchaindb-01.png' import bigchaindb01 from './portfolio-bigchaindb-01.png'
import bigchaindb02 from './portfolio-bigchaindb-02.png' import bigchaindb02 from './portfolio-bigchaindb-02.png'
import bigchaindb03 from './portfolio-bigchaindb-03.png'
import chartmogul from './portfolio-chartmogul.png' import chartmogul from './portfolio-chartmogul.png'
import chartmogul01 from './portfolio-chartmogul-01.png' import chartmogul01 from './portfolio-chartmogul-01.png'
import chartmogul02 from './portfolio-chartmogul-02.png' import chartmogul02 from './portfolio-chartmogul-02.png'
@ -22,12 +27,17 @@ import outofwhaleoil02 from './portfolio-outofwhaleoil-02.png'
export default { export default {
oceanprotocol, oceanprotocol,
oceanprotocol01,
oceanprotocol02,
ipdb, ipdb,
ipdb01,
ipdb02,
biv, biv,
ninenineeightfour, ninenineeightfour,
bigchaindb, bigchaindb,
bigchaindb01, bigchaindb01,
bigchaindb02, bigchaindb02,
bigchaindb03,
chartmogul, chartmogul,
chartmogul01, chartmogul01,
chartmogul02, chartmogul02,

Binary file not shown.

After

Width:  |  Height:  |  Size: 409 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 298 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 66 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 351 KiB

Binary file not shown.

After

Width:  |  Height:  |  Size: 113 KiB

View File

@ -6,15 +6,15 @@ import Header from '../components/molecules/Header'
import Footer from '../components/molecules/Footer' import Footer from '../components/molecules/Footer'
import './index.scss' import './index.scss'
const TemplateWrapper = props => { const TemplateWrapper = ({ data, location, children }) => {
const meta = props.data.allDataJson.edges[0].node const meta = data.allDataJson.edges[0].node
const isHomepage = props.location.pathname === '/' const isHomepage = location.pathname === '/'
return ( return (
<div className="app"> <div className="app">
<Head meta={meta} /> <Head meta={meta} />
<Header meta={meta} isHomepage={isHomepage} /> <Header meta={meta} isHomepage={isHomepage} />
<FadeIn>{props.children()}</FadeIn> <FadeIn>{children()}</FadeIn>
<Footer meta={meta} /> <Footer meta={meta} />
</div> </div>
) )